Chelsea planning swoop for Bayer Leverkusen defender

Chelsea are reportedly planning an approach to sign Bayer Leverkusen defender Edmond Tapsoba at the end of the season.
The Blues have had another tough Premier League campaign and they have been hugely disappointing in a defensive point of view.
They are likely to invest on a marquee centre-back this summer, particularly with Thiago Silva expected to be released after the season.
Tapsoba has been identified as a top target by the hierarchy, but he won't come on the cheap with a €60m release clause in his deal.
Furthermore, the Blues face competition. Tottenham Hotspur are long-term admirers while Manchester United are also keeping tabs.
The Burundi international has been a mainstay in the back three for Leverkusen and it won't be easy to convince him too.
With manager Xabi Alonso confirming his plans to continue at Leverkusen, some of their star players could decide to prolong their stays.
Chelsea are also keen on Sporting's Ousmane Diomande, but Arsenal have an upper hand in the race due to Champions League football.
